The Port of Santos is situated in the town that has the same name in the coast of southeastern Brazilian state of Sao Paulo. It is the port that transported most of the goods to the Arab countries in the year 2005. Goods worth at US$ 2.1 billion moved across the terminal heading towards the Arab countries in North Africa and the Middle East. In conditions of quantity, shipments reached 5.3 million tons. There are 64 private terminals at the Port of Santos and total area is 7.7 million square kilometers. It gave refuge to 44.7% of the Brazil's exports to the Arab states, which made a sum of US$ 4.7 billion up to November, 2005. It is also a chief transshipment port for good and commodities created in all the Southern cone countries (Brazil, Chile, Paraguay, Argentina, Bolivia and Uruguay). For instance, in the past, Santos went beyond Buenos Aires as Latin America's second-largest manager of containers. Land access and division within the ports are two important issues. The port is provided by quickly to be finished toll road that supplies high powered, quick access to So Paulo. Just about 90 % of the export and import cargo is conceded or from the port by trucks. There are Five railway companies, under allowance since 2000, serve the port. The port had an aim of covering 10 million tons of load carried by rail at the end of 2002, an ambition that was met. Investments of rail facilities in the port possessions and use of concessions have radically improved the efficiency of rail car use. 20% of container traffic from the port is controlled by rail, around twenty thousand TEUs per month. Rail investment in infrastructure on port possessions is a significant factor of increased access to the port. With no corresponding investment in rail infrastructure In further elements of the state, however, the use of rail for shifting goods also from the port will be limited. Projects are being generated that will permit leasing of rail infrastructure for private workers, created investment dollars. Rail services, in amalgamation with inland water barge, symbolize a significant access mode for agricultural commodities, particularly soy.
